intercut
verb: If a film is intercut with particular images, those images appear regularly throughout the film.

intercut in American English
to interrupt (a scene, sequence, etc.) by inserting (a shot, sequence, etc.), sometimes repeatedly
intransitive verb: to cut from one type of shot to another, as from a long shot to a closeup
noun: a film sequence or scene produced by intercutting
transitive verb: to insert (shots from other scenes, flashbacks, etc.) into the narrative of a film
